Android屏幕关闭前的BroadcastReceiver
创始人
2024-10-09 13:01:24
0

要实现在 Android 屏幕关闭前收到广播的功能,可以使用以下步骤:

  1. 创建一个 BroadcastReceiver 类,并在其中重写 onReceive() 方法。该方法将在接收到指定广播时被调用。
public class ScreenOffReceiver extends BroadcastReceiver {
    @Override
    public void onReceive(Context context, Intent intent) {
        if (Intent.ACTION_SCREEN_OFF.equals(intent.getAction())) {
            // 在屏幕关闭前执行的操作
            Log.d("ScreenOffReceiver", "Screen is about to turn off");
        }
    }
}
  1. 在 AndroidManifest.xml 文件中注册 BroadcastReceiver。添加以下代码到 标签内:

    
        
    

  1. 确保在 AndroidManifest.xml 文件中添加以下权限:

  1. 在需要接收屏幕关闭前广播的地方,注册 BroadcastReceiver。例如,在一个 Activity 的 onCreate() 方法中添加以下代码:
ScreenOffReceiver screenOffReceiver = new ScreenOffReceiver();
IntentFilter intentFilter = new IntentFilter(Intent.ACTION_SCREEN_OFF);
registerReceiver(screenOffReceiver, intentFilter);

这样,当屏幕关闭前,你将收到一个名为 "android.intent.action.SCREEN_OFF" 的广播,并且可以在 ScreenOffReceiver 类的 onReceive() 方法中执行你想要的操作。

相关内容

热门资讯

黑科技辅助挂(wepoKe)黑... 黑科技辅助挂(wepoKe)黑科技透明挂辅助技巧(透视)专业教程(一直真的有挂)1、不需要AI权限,...
黑科技挂(wEPOKE)黑科技... 黑科技挂(wEPOKE)黑科技透明挂辅助安装(透视)攻略教程(一贯有挂)暗藏猫腻,小编详细说明wEP...
黑科技辅助挂(wEpOke)黑... 黑科技辅助挂(wEpOke)黑科技透明挂辅助安装(透视)可靠教程(本来存在有挂);1、下载好wEpO...
黑科技软件(aapoker)外... 黑科技软件(aapoker)外挂辅助下载(透视)介绍教程(原来真的有挂)aapoker辅助器中分为三...
黑科技真的(wpk俱乐部)外挂... 黑科技真的(wpk俱乐部)外挂透视辅助助手(透视)透视教程(真是真的是有挂)wpk俱乐部是一种具有地...
黑科技中牌率(wEpOke)黑... 黑科技中牌率(wEpOke)黑科技透明挂辅助助手(透视)2025新版教程(果然是真的有挂);1)wE...
黑科技新版(we-poker)... 黑科技新版(we-poker)黑科技透明挂辅助技巧(透视)透明教程(其实是真的有挂)1、进入游戏-大...
黑科技辅助挂(AAPOKEr)... 黑科技辅助挂(AAPOKEr)外挂透视辅助安装(透视)微扑克教程(确实真的是有挂)1、许多玩家不知道...
黑科技免费(德州之星)外挂辅助... 黑科技免费(德州之星)外挂辅助神器(透视)安装教程(确实是真的有挂);1)德州之星辅助挂:进一步探索...
黑科技有挂(德州wepower... 黑科技有挂(德州wepower)黑科技透明挂辅助下载(透视)揭秘教程(其实是有挂)1、任何德州wep...